Handover note — Crumbwheel order cutoffs.

Welcome aboard. The bakery cutoff rule in Crumbwheel closes same-day orders at 14:00 local to each storefront, not UTC — this has bitten us twice. Holiday overrides live in the calendar service and take precedence silently, so always check there first when a cutoff looks wrong. To unlock the calendar service's admin console after a restart, enter the recovery passphrase below.

vault phrase of bagap-bahaf = silion-pelox-sorox-casdor-quenwyn-fraax-eliox-praael-kelion-quenvan-kasox-rusael-norius-belvan

**Ticket PARITY-412: Kestrel SDK catch-up**

Quick one for the weekly sync: the Kestrel-Go SDK is still missing batched uploads and retry hints that Kestrel-JS shipped two releases ago. Partner teams keep asking. Plan is to land both behind a flag this sprint and cut a minor release. Needs a sign-off from the owner named below.

account owner for bajef-badup: Drueth Kelath Pelael Holwyn

Subject: DR drill Thursday — pooler failover

Quick brief for the drill. We'll fail the primary Kestrelbase pooler in the Dunmere region and verify the replica pool absorbs connections within 90 seconds. Your part: watch pool saturation on the contractor dashboard and log any connection refusals. Don't touch max-connection settings during the drill. Keep checkout sessions out of the test window. If the failover console challenges you for emergency access, use the recovery passphrase immediately below.

recovery phrase for yahag-yagap: pramir-normir-norius-kasax